Product Description

The ISCAR 5508455 is a carbide replaceable tip drill insert from the ICM series, designed for precision drilling in demanding industrial applications. Manufactured under the IC908 grade using a submicron carbide substrate, this tip features a TiAlN coating applied via PVD process for improved wear resistance and heat dissipation at the cutting edge. The drill tip measures 0.591 inches in cutting diameter with a 140-degree included angle and a thinned web point geometry. Its slow spiral, T-Land flute design promotes controlled chip evacuation. The insert is held in place via twist-style seating and conforms to ISO 13399 standards. Installation is performed by qualified machinists in CNC or manual drilling operations.

This replaceable tip is engineered for primary use in stainless steel, superalloys, and titanium workpieces, with secondary suitability for steel, cast iron, and hard materials. It fits into Series ICM drill bodies using an ISO Number ICM 150 seat configuration, making it applicable in aerospace, energy, and precision manufacturing environments where tight tolerances and difficult-to-machine alloys are common. The 0.344-inch overall projection height and T-Land geometry support stable entry and reduced radial forces in interrupted or solid material drilling.

Installation Notes

Replaceable tip drills of this type are installed and changed by machinists or tooling technicians following machine lockout and spindle stop procedures. Use the appropriate ISCAR torx or hex key to seat the tip securely in the drill body; do not overtighten or use impact tools on the insert screw. Confirm seating alignment before resuming operation. Follow the drill body manufacturer's recommended clamping procedure and inspect the seat for wear or debris before each tip change.
